    C450

    Image_1.jpg
    Top half if image is side one (prints clean), bottom half is second side (pinholes in halftone areas). This happens in black only and color. Tried different paper stock, no change. -- HELP!

        Re: C450

        OK -- Changed the 2nd transfer roller, reset transfer adjustments, cleaned sensors, no more pin holes in the non-solids. Now, only on the second side, and only in the black image I'm getting this. I know it's New Year's Eve, I'll get my bubbles later!

        Image_2.jpg

        Tried to replace the black IU, but got 'wrong IU installed' error and had to put the original back temporarily.

          this is a lack of humidity issue your 2nd transfer settings should take care of this, however there is a high altitude setting you can try. setting this makes doing gradation impossible.
